Land contracts typically work in a unique fashion where a balloon payment, or lump sum, comes at the end of the repayment period after the repayment plan is negotiated between the two parties.Assumable mortgage: An assumable mortgage is a type of home financing in which buyers are given the opportunity to purchase a home by assuming responsibility for and taking over the seller’s current mortgage (especially if it’s charged at a lower interest rate).Lease purchase: Also known as a rent-to-own contract, a lease purchase agreement speaks to a form of agreement under which renters pay sellers an option fee at an agreed-upon purchase price that gives the renter the exclusive lease option to purchase the property at a later date.Land loans: A land loan is used to facilitate and finance the purchase of a plot of land for later use for residential or business purposes.Holding mortgage: Under a holding mortgage agreement, a homeowner agrees to serve as a lender for the home buyer, and provides a loan for the purchase, which the buyer repays by making monthly payments to the seller.
